Transaction 211560db78ca685809616c98b2869f6c4052f364dd27f1a68a56c7cacee66ab0
1 Input
1 Output
-
211560db78ca685809616c98b2869f6c4052f364dd27f1a68a56c7cacee66ab0:0
- value
- 5613339
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2efaaf9e83ea69a7863bd3d738117096d2894c06 OP_EQUAL
- address
- 35yRKLXU18u7qsemML3fLfSFsUPp54FQ1L